#include <android/bitmap.h>
#include <GraphicsJNI.h>

int AndroidBitmap_getInfo(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ap,
                          AndroidBitmapInfo* info) {
    if (NULL == env || NULL == jbitmap)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_BAD_PARAMETER;
    }

    SkBitmap* bm = GraphicsJNI::getNativeBitmap(env, jbitmap);
    if (NULL == bm)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_JNI_EXCEPTION;
    }

    if (info) {
        info->width     = bm->width();
        info->height    = bm->height();
        info->stride    = bm->rowBytes();
        info->flags     = 0;

        switch (bm->config()) {
            case SkBitmap::kARGB_8888_Config:
                info->format = 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GBA_8888;
                break;
            case SkBitmap::kRGB_565_Config:
                info->format = 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GB_565;
                break;
            case SkBitmap::kARGB_4444_Config:
                info->format = 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GBA_4444;
                break;
            case SkBitmap::kA8_Config:
                info->format = 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_A_8;
                break;
            default:
                info->format = 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_NONE;
                break;
        }
    }
    return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ESUT_SUCCESS;
}

int AndroidBitmap_lockPixels(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ap, void** addrPtr) {
    if (NULL == env || NULL == jbitmap)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_BAD_PARAMETER;
    }

    SkBitmap* bm = GraphicsJNI::getNativeBitmap(env, jbitmap);
    if (NULL == bm)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_JNI_EXCEPTION;
    }

    bm->lockPixels();
    void* addr = bm->getPixels();
    if (NULL == addr) {
        bm->unlockPixels();
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_ALLOCATION_FAILED;
    }

    if (addrPtr) {
        *addrPtr = addr;
    }
    return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ESUT_SUCCESS;
}

int AndroidBitmap_unlockPixels(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ap) {
    if (NULL == env || NULL == jbitmap)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_BAD_PARAMETER;
    }

    SkBitmap* bm = GraphicsJNI::getNativeBitmap(env, jbitmap);
    if (NULL == bm) {
        return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_JNI_EXCEPTION;
    }

    bm->unlockPixels();
    return ANDROID_BITMAP_RESUT_SUCCESS;
}

#ifndef ANDROID_BITMAP_H
#define ANDROID_BITMAP_H

#include <stdint.h>
#include <jni.h>

#ifdef __cplusplus
extern "C" {
#endif

#define ANDROID_BITMAP_RESUT_SUCCESS            0
#define 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_BAD_PARAMETER     -1
#define 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_JNI_EXCEPTION     -2
#define ANDROID_BITMAP_RESULT_ALLOCATION_FAILED -3

enum AndroidBitmapFormat {
    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_NONE      = 0,
    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GBA_8888 = 1,
    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GB_565   = 4,
    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_RGBA_4444 = 7,
    ANDROID_BITMAP_FORMAT_A_8       = 8,
};

typedef struct {
    uint32_t    width;
    uint32_t    height;
    uint32_t    stride;
    int32_t     format;
    uint32_t    flags;      // 0 for now
} AndroidBitmapInfo;

/**
 * Given a java bitmap object, fill out the AndroidBitmap struct for it.
 * If the call fails, the info parameter will be ignored
 */
int AndroidBitmap_getInfo(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ap,
                          AndroidBitmapInfo* info);

/**
 * Given a java bitmap object, attempt to lock the pixel address.
 * Locking will ensure that the memory for the pixels will not move
 * until the unlockPixels call, and ensure that, if the pixels had been
 * previously purged, they will have been restored.
 *
 * If this call succeeds, it must be balanced by a call to
 * AndroidBitmap_unlockPixels, after which time the address of the pixels should
 * no longer be used.
 *
 * If this succeeds, *addrPtr will be set to the pixel address. If the call
 * fails, addrPtr will be ignored.
 */
int AndroidBitmap_lockPixels(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ap, void** addrPtr);

/**
 * Call this to balanace a successful call to AndroidBitmap_lockPixels
 */
int AndroidBitmap_unlockPixels(JNIEnv* env, jobject jbitmap);

#ifdef __cplusplus
}
#endif

#endif
